Dylan Duffy

3 (5) – 0 Goals

Sold mid-season, Dylan never quite found his place. Played out of position early on and didn’t have much chance to impress. The betting issues at the season’s start didn’t help. A player who might’ve offered more in a different setup.

4/10

Ethan Erhahon

27 (3) – 0 Goals

Injury and suspension disrupted what could’ve been a dominant campaign. When fit, Ethan has been excellent and always one of the better players on the pitch. However, his actual impact this season has been disrupted, and the moment at Bolton left many fans with a slightly lower view of him. Still, he’ll be a top target for clubs this summer, and rightly so.

7/10

Joe Gardner

3 (7) – 1 Goal

Joe’s early red card was a tough introduction to the EFL. Since then, he’s had moments, but not enough to earn a higher-level loan, which is good news for us. He fits the current system well and may yet return, with fans likely open to a reunion.

6/10

Reeco Hackett

22 (10) – 4 Goals

Reeco’s season has been a tale of inconsistency. Played as a left wing back for much of the year, he only truly shone when pushed further forward. Tricky, creative, but streaky — capable of brilliance, but not always present. When he’s good, he’s very good, but that isn’t something we see every week.

6/10
